Job summary

Union for Reform Judaism’s 6 Points Camp seeks an Assistant Director to help create exceptional summer and year-round camp experiences for campers, families, and staff. You will partner with Camp Directors to foster belonging and leadership through immersive STEAM experiences and Jewish life.

The role blends relationship-building, operations, and community engagement, overseeing staff recruitment, partnerships with families, and safe, high-quality programs from inquiry through season end.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ent combination of education and relevant experience.
  • Experience in camping, youth development, education, nonprofit leadership, or a related field.
  • Demonstrated success building relationships with youth, families, volunteers, and community partners.
  • Strong organizational and project management skills, with the ability to manage multiple priorities simultaneously.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office, Google Workspace, and enrollment or CRM systems is preferred.

Responsibilities

  • Provide Camp Leadership: Partner with the Camp leadership team to advance the camp's mission, support strategic priorities, and strengthen organizational culture.
  • Serve as a visible leader who models Jewish values, fosters belonging, and contributes to the continued growth and success of the camp and the broader URJ Camping System.
  • Help lead day-to-day camp operations and assume leadership responsibilities as needed throughout the year and during the summer season.
  • Collaborate across the URJ Camping System to share best practices, participate in professional learning, and strengthen system-wide initiatives.
  • Oversee operational systems that camper and staff administration, travel logistics, parent communication, staff hiring paperwork, prospect management, and other core camp functions.
  • Partner with the Business Manager and camp leadership to ensure efficient operations and seamless coordination across functional areas.
  • Continuously improve operational processes and systems to enhance the experience of campers, families, and staff while supporting the camp's long-term success.
  • Lead strategies that attract, engage, and retain campers, families, and seasonal staff while strengthening relationships with congregations and community partners.
  • Oversee the camper and family experience, ensuring responsive communication, personalized support, and exceptional customer service.
  • Support accommodations and individualized needs to ensure every camper has an inclusive and successful camp experience.
  • Supervise designated staff and help deliver engaging summer and year-round programs that foster meaningful connections to camp and Jewish life.
  • Foster a camp environment where every camper and staff member feels safe, supported, valued, and empowered to thrive.
  • Promote a culture of belonging, well-being, accountability, and respect that reflects Jewish values and the URJ's commitment to inclusion.
  • Champion inclusive practices that create equitable experiences for campers and staff from diverse backgrounds.
  • Help ensure compliance with URJ policies, American Camp Association (ACA) standards, and applicable health, safety, security, and risk management requirements.
